Write the equation of the line that is parallel to the line y = 2x + 2 and passes through the point (5, 3)?. .

Mathematics
1 answer:
ohaa [14]3 years ago
6 0
The equation of the line given is 2 from the equation y = mx + b where m is the slope. For the lines to be parallel, their slopes should be equal. The equation of the line may also be expressed as, 
                                  y - y1 = m(x - x1)
Substituting the values,
                                  y - 3 = 2(x - 5)
The simplified form of the equation is,
                                   y = 2x - 7

A baseball player hit 65 home runs in a season. Of the 65 home​ runs, 19 went to right​ field, 23 went to right-center​ field, 9
olchik [2.2K]

Answer:

a) 29.23% probability that a randomly selected home run was hit to right field

b) 29.23% probability that a randomly selected home run was hit to right field, which is not lower than 5% nor it is higher than 95%. So it was not unusual for this player to hit a home run to right field.

Step-by-step explanation:

A probability is the number of desired outcomes divided by the number of total outcomes. It is said to be unusual if it is lower than 5% or higher than 95%.

(a) What is the probability that a randomly selected home run was hit to right field?

Desired outcomes:

19 home runs hit to right field

Total outcomes:

65 home runs

19/65 = 0.2923

29.23% probability that a randomly selected home run was hit to right field

(b) Was it unusual for this player to hit a home run to right field?

29.23% probability that a randomly selected home run was hit to right field, which is not lower than 5% nor it is higher than 95%. So it was not unusual for this player to hit a home run to right field.
